2016 CZK to JPY Performance & Market Timing Review

Analysis of key historical highlights and timing insights for 2016

During 2016, the CZK to JPY exchange rate experienced significant fluctuation. The market reached its absolute peak on February 1, valuing the pair at 4.8725. Conversely, the yearly low was recorded on July 9, dropping to 4.1121.

This high-to-low spread represents a total annual volatility of 0.7604 JPY. From a start-to-finish perspective, comparing the January average rate of 4.7636 to the December average rate of 4.5243, the exchange rate registered a net change of -5.02% (reflecting a weakening trend).

Looking at year-over-year peak valuations, the 2016 high of 4.8725 was down 6.92% compared to the 2015 peak of 5.2348, indicating shifts in long-term support levels.

Seasonal Halves (H1 vs H2)

Seasonal

The average exchange rate in the first half of the year (H1: Jan–Jun) was 4.6088, compared to 4.2947 in the second half (H2: Jul–Dec). This shows that the rate was stronger in the first half (Jan–Jun) by a margin of 0.3141 points.

Volatility Range Comparison

Volatility

The most volatile month in 2016 was June, with a trading range of 0.3957 JPY (High: 4.5414 / Low: 4.1457). On the other end, May was the most stable month, with a tight range of 0.0739 JPY (High: 4.5894 / Low: 4.5154).

Growth Streaks & Declines

Trends

Between August and December, the exchange rate recorded its longest consecutive growth streak of the year, climbing for 4 straight months. Conversely, the sharpest month-over-month decline occurred between May and June, when the average rate fell by 0.1704 points.
